The Implementation of Database Partitioning Based on Streaming Framework
Horizontal and vertical partitioning can increase the performance of the database and simplify data management.However traditional partitioning techniques cant deal with stream queries efficiently.In this paper we present WSPS: a workload-driven stream partitioning system to solve the above problem by the integration of partitioning technology and streaming framework.We construct a dynamic data model, cluster and merge nodes according to the node affinity, then get the optimal partitioning scheme according to a cost model.WSPS can deal with stream data and obtain real time partitioning scheme.Experimental results show that WSPS can improve the partitioning efficiency and reduce the computing complexity.Additionally, WSPS has good performance on horizontal scaling and high-throughput adaption.
